Anyone use Paypal a bit?

Featured Replies

Just wondered if anyone knows if they have changed their paying speed, i.e when you withdraw a balance. Usually it takes about 3 to 4 working days, but for the first time yesterday I had the amount withdrawn showing in my bank account online within 1 hour!

Just curious really. All for the better!

They did change a few things. If you sell something and transfer the money to your bank account on the spot, they put a hold for 22 hours (don't ask me why is 22 hours?) and after that they credit your bank on the spot. However if you had money in your PayPal for a few days and going to transfer to your bank is almost instantaneously. This is much better than the old 3/4 days :)
